Description
Designed in collaboration with Joe Duplantier of Gojira, the JOE DUPLANTIER SIGNATURE PRO-MOD SAN DIMAS® STYLE 2 is a powerhouse solid body electric guitar that caters to the extreme demands of modern metal. Crafted with an all-mahogany body, this guitar exudes durability and resonance, making it a striking presence on any stage. The mahogany neck, paired with a sleek ebony fingerboard, provides a responsive feel that's perfect for both intricate solos and aggressive riffs.
At the heart of this guitar are the DiMarzio PAF 36th Anniversary neck pickup and the Joe Duplantier Signature DiMarzio Fortitude bridge pickup, delivering a dynamic range of tones from classic warmth to savage crunch. The special contoured heel and heel-mount truss rod adjustment wheel ensure effortless playability and quick neck relief adjustments. Featuring a compound-radius fingerboard that transitions smoothly from 12” to 16”, and 22 jumbo frets, the guitar is built for speed and precision.
The Pro-Mod's thoughtful design extends to its hardware, including a compound-radius compensated bridge with an anchored tailpiece, Charvel locking tuners, and a knurled volume control knob strategically positioned for uninterrupted play. Finished in natural satin to showcase the raw wood grain, with subtle chrome hardware and a black pickguard, this guitar balances elegance with ferocity, making it a standout choice for players who demand both performance and aesthetics.
Key Features:
- All-mahogany body and neck with ebony fingerboard
- DiMarzio PAF 36th Anniversary neck pickup and Joe Duplantier Signature DiMarzio Fortitude bridge pickup
- Special contoured heel for upper fret access
- Heel-mount truss rod adjustment wheel
- 12”-16” compound-radius fingerboard
- 22 jumbo frets with pearloid big block inlays
- Charvel locking tuners and compound-radius compensated bridge

Owner Insights
We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about JOE DUPLANTIER SIGNATURE PRO-MOD SAN DIMAS® STYLE 2.
Features and functionality
-
The Fortitude pickups are described as modded PAFs, offering a non-overpowering sound suitable for heavy music like Gojira.
Source -
The guitar is notably lighter than a Les Paul Studio, enhancing its playability for those used to heavier models.
Source -
The locking tuners maintain tuning stability effectively, requiring minimal adjustments even with new strings.
Source
Build quality
Setup and maintenance
-
Some units have been reported with nut and bridge issues, requiring replacement to improve playability.
Source
Mods and upgrades
-
Adding a series/parallel switch to the volume pot is recommended for more tonal versatility.
Source
Value and pricing
-
A price of $600 for a well-maintained model is considered reasonable by multiple owners.
Source
Use cases and applications
-
The guitar is noted for its capability to produce heavy, chugging tones, fitting styles like metal and hard rock.
Source -
It's well-suited for D tuning and drop C, aligning with Gojira's typical tunings.
Source -
Users report that the guitar can closely replicate the tone of Gojira's "Magma" album, enhancing the playing experience for fans of the band.
Source
